Monday - Kitchen and dining room
Level One
Clear and wipe worksurfaces
Do items 2 and 7 from your frog list!!!
Level Two
Wipe and replace small appliances
Scrub down the front of units and large appliances and kickboards
Wash all the skirtings and door and window frames!
Level Three
Wipe the table[STRIKE]and chairs[/STRIKE]
Sweep and mop the floor
Degunge the fridge!
Extras- Thoroughly clean the tins/jars cupboard!
- Run the WM's and DW's through a clean cycle
- Clean all the filters and door seals etc
- Wipe the back door down.. inside.. and out!!

[QUOTE=
BTW does anyone know what to remove tea stains out of cups with?[/QUOTE]
I either soak for a few hours in biological washing powder and hot water, or wipe neat bleach around inside of cups then fill with water for a few minutes, either way remember to rinse THOROUGHLY before use0 -
